Introduction:

Heerfordt Syndrome, also known as uveoparotid fever, is a rare manifestation of sarcoidosis characterized by a specific set of symptoms. This condition, while infrequent, poses unique diagnostic and therapeutic challenges. This article provides a detailed understanding of Heerfordt Syndrome, its symptoms, causes, diagnostic approaches, and treatment options.

Understanding Heerfordt Syndrome:

Heerfordt Syndrome is a form of sarcoidosis, an inflammatory disease that can affect multiple organs. This syndrome specifically involves inflammation of the eye (uveitis), swelling of the parotid gland, facial nerve palsy, and fever.

Symptoms:

The hallmark symptoms of Heerfordt Syndrome include:

  • Uveitis: Inflammation of the uvea, the middle layer of the eye, causing redness, pain, and blurred vision.
  • Parotid Gland Enlargement: Leading to facial swelling near the jaw.
  • Facial Nerve Palsy: Resulting in muscle weakness on one side of the face.
  • Additional symptoms can include fatigue, weight loss, and aching joints.

Causes:

The exact cause of Heerfordt Syndrome, like sarcoidosis, remains unknown. It is believed to be an autoimmune reaction, possibly triggered by environmental or genetic factors.

Diagnosis:

Diagnosing Heerfordt Syndrome typically involves:

  • Clinical Evaluation: Based on the characteristic symptoms.
  • Blood Tests: To check for markers of inflammation and organ function.
  • Imaging Studies: Such as CT or MRI scans to assess organ involvement.
  • Biopsy: Often of the affected salivary gland, to confirm granulomatous inflammation indicative of sarcoidosis.

Treatment:

Treatment focuses on managing the symptoms and controlling the inflammation:

  • Corticosteroids: Prednisone or similar medications to reduce inflammation.
  • Immunosuppressive Medications: In cases where steroids are not effective or for long-term management.
  • Topical Treatments: For uveitis, such as corticosteroid eye drops.
  • Physical Therapy: For facial nerve palsy.
